Crystal structure of a monometal state of the ribonucleotide-reductase small subunit from Epstein-Barr virus in monoclinic space group

Template:ABSTRACT PUBMED 22824004

About this Structure

4a5c is a 2 chain structure with sequence from Human herpesvirus 4. Full crystallographic information is available from OCA.
